1. Teacher distributes some words


and pupils have to work in group to
categorize the words in singular or
plural nouns.
2. Teacher checks the words.
3. Introduce and explain the concept
of common nouns. Provide
examples/realia in the classroom to
the pupils.
4. Distribute A4 paper. Let them
explore the nouns around them
and write the nouns in mind-map.
5. Pupils can use dictionary for
correct spelling.
6. Teacher checks their answers.
7. Choose at random and ask the
pupils to fill in the blanks and
answer the exercise on the
whiteboard.
8. Class discussion and pupils rewrite
the correct answer in the exercise
book.

Steps
1. Cut out many copies of the
pattern pieces.
2. Score, fold, and glue the large
piece into a hexagonal tube to
form the cell walls.
3. Glue the tabs of end cap to the
inside of the cell walls.
4. Glue the cells together to form a
honeycomb.
